Abstract

Bitcoin is a kind of novel distributed electronic cash free of any governmental influence and supervision. Its irreversibility, pseudonymity and unforgeability have made great developmental leaps in means of payment and investment management. However, when the application of the means of payment is applied in small and medium-sized enterprises or companies, bitcoin lacks the mechanism to be jointly managed. We propose a Distributed Bitcoin Account Management (DBAM) framework that realizes joint management of bitcoin accounts applied especially to enterprises and companies. The framework incorporates secret sharing and attribute based encryption schemes compatible with the existing bitcoin protocols. Each bitcoin account achieves fine-grained management of participants and prevents the private key from being unexpectedly recovered. Thorough analyses show that our framework is secure, practical and effective.
